An early reader chapter book that explores STEM through baking.Grandma Rose's birthday is coming up, and Mira wants to surprise her with a homemade cake shaped like a unicorn (because who doesn't love unicorns?) But Mira has never used a recipe before! She faces all sorts of baking mysteries: What does 1/2 mean? How do you measure flour? And how do you turn a rectangle into a unicorn?With help from her older sister Layla, Mira learns that recipes are like puzzles waiting to be solved. Each ingredient teaches her something new about fractions, measurement, and following directions. Mira's Baking Adventures: The Unicorn Cake makes math engaging and accessible, and is perfect for young readers who love hands-on learning, problem-solving, and stories about kids who don't give up! Ideal for: Independent readers ages 6-8Classroom and homeschool settingsParents looking for books that make STEM funKids who love baking or want to learnSupplementing lessons on fractions, measurement, and following instructionsMira's Baking Adventures is a chapter book series that teaches math, science, and world cultures through the universal language of food.
